S/390: Split MVC instruction for better forwarding
Certain lengths used in an MVC instruction might disable operand forwarding. Split MVCs into up to 2 forwardable ones if possible. gcc/ChangeLog: 2017-12-01 Andreas Krebbel <krebbel@linux.vnet.ibm.com> * config/s390/predicates.md (plus16_Q_operand): New predicate. * config/s390/s390.md: Disable MVC merging peephole if it would disable operand forwarding. (new peephole2): Split MVCs if it would turn them into up to 2 forwardable MVCs. From-SVN: r255319
